It isn't a far stroll to your next destination. Though despite it only being a street away, to Xiaoqing it feels different. She opts to walk barefoot, and is garbed in something perhaps more gorgeous than she ever dreamed of ever wearing. As somebody else from Earth, you understand completely, though on top of the cultural shock between your home world and Absoterra, this is a girl who has been disguised as a boy for some time now. The way she carries herself now is like she's stepping through a dream. She feels the flutter of her dress upon her skin, and the touch of stone below, with dirt between her toes. As the wind picks up, a breeze wafts freely through her pale blue hair.

But then she pulls back. You watch as she emotionally withdraws. Her arms pull in, and she glances around her nervously.

You offer up your palm, whether she wishes to take hold or not. "It's all right," you say just as you notice her discomfort. "In the Empire of Tivera, nobody knows the name Xiaoqing. And when they learn, it'll be attributed a beautiful women of ice and snow. A frosted princess. People will say things like... wow, that Xiaoqing sure is pretty. I can't even look her way without blushing. What I wouldn't do just to feel her touch."

With pink in her cheeks, she giggles, and then lays her hand upon yours. You walk side-by-side, held tight, as Nyllia continues to lead the way. It isn't much longer, however, as before you know it, the shop is right up ahead.

"CobbleStone," whispers Xiaoqing as her eyes scan the sign above the door.

Nyllia nods. "That is right. Come on now, before your toes start to freeze. Ah, perhaps that is not so much an issue for you. Either way, follow me."

The door turns open with a creak--not a bell or chime, nor likely something set up on purpose, but it does the charm. A man nearby twists his head around the moment you make yourselves known. The first thing you notice are two feline ears sticking up from his head, with hair like a bowl cut--silver, though when you see his face, you can see that he isn't at all elderly. He's likely around the age of yourself.

He stands from where he was previously kneeling. His attire is finely stitched--top like a kimono shirt, and dark loose pants. You can barely make out his eyes through the thickness of his spectacle lenses, but you can at least tell that he's looking at you. With a hand formally on his chest, he bows his head and greets his customers. "Welcome," he says. "Ah. Such incredibly well-dressed individuals. I presume this is for the queen's appearance this evening."

"You are correct," answers Nyllia.

Upon noticing her presence, the catfolk gasps. "Lady Tesgella! I haven't seen you in a long time. Are you in need of new footwear? No, that's not right. It must be for the one amongst you with bare feet."

You walk Xiaoqing forwards. "Yeah. She needs something that will go perfectly with her new dress," you explain.

"It would be an honour," the man answers.

Nyllia then looks to you. "This is Mr. Stone, a very talented cobbler. I believe he is perfect for the job."

"You flatter me," he says. "But you're correct. Here, sit down on this chair and we'll have a look, madame."

Released from your hand, Xiaoqing steps over to a wooden seat, grabs her dress, and carefully sits.

The cobbler then tosses you two items. The first is a balled up measuring tape, and the other is a cloth. You catch both.

"What are these for?" you ask.

"I need you to wipe down her feet, and then measure them for me. Meanwhile, I'll find the perfect pair and tailor them to fit. Excuse me." He then disappears behind a counter at the far end of the room. Many drawers and cabinets are opened, and he takes down a few on display as well.

You look to her. She looks back. Then with a shrug, you kneel down before her and take hold of her right ankle. They aren't filthy, but she was just walking barefoot outside. You take the cloth and clean the loose dirt, though almost immediately, you feel her entire leg flinch. Her toes wiggle as she giggles, though in a manner that brings her immediate embarrassment.

She looks down and whispers, "Careful... I'm sensitive, and ticklish there."

You chuckle. "I'll try."

After wiping them down, you stretch out the tape, and hold it from her heel to the tips of her toes. Though just as before, every time your hands touch the bottoms of her feet, she fidgets in place, and tries not to break into a fit of cackling. Eventually, you lock eyes. She smiles, and you return the favour.

When you finally finish, you bring the measurements to Mr. Stone.

"Just a question," you speak up. "Why did you want me to do it? Aren't you the expert?"

He then freezes in place. Slowly, the catfolk turns and looks you in the eyes--as much as you can tell through his thick glasses--and then places a hand upon your shoulder. "Sir. You are their man. I would never touch the feet of somebody's partner so intimately. For Lady Tesgella to have found love, it warms my heart. And it's a man with enough love within him to have not one, but two beautiful women at his side. Those are your feet, sir. All four. Not mine. Yours. Care for them well."

"... All right."

"And I've got the perfect shoes!" He slaps his hand down upon the counter. "Wait shortly. I won't be long."

"Mmm... What's with all the noise?" comes a new voice--one very sleepy.

Standing in the doorway to another room is a woman with baggy pajama pants and a top only halfway buttoned, slipping partly off her shoulder. She has an orange bob-cut, though it's incredibly messy, and she wears thick glasses. The prescription may not be as intense as the other's, but they're large with black, bold frames. Cat ears top her head twitch, and her tail sways to and fro. After a moment of looking her over, you realize that you recognize her from somewhere.

It's Ms. Labing, the seamstress at Redbloom Academy!

"Sister, please. I have customers," Mr. Stone replies.

"Huh?" Ms. Labing looks blankly at you before gasping. She pulls her top closed, and retreats back around the corner. "I didn't know!"

"Have you not heard our conversation?"

"I thought you were talking to yourself again."

Emerging once again, though properly buttoned, Ms. Labing has the chance to inspect you more thoroughly. "By the gods. Is that... Kyle Warren? It is!" It's as if she were never embarrassed. Swiftly, she hops right in front of you and smiles bright. Her hands touch down your regal attire. She runs her fingers down the lining, and tugs gently on the fabric. "Incredible," she whispers. "Who made this?"

"Luna, of Luna Silk at Castle Phoenix," you proudly answer. "And it's good to see you again."

"What an amazing coincidence. The man behind me there is my brother. I was just visiting him. This evening, we're going to watch the queen together. Ooh, I do love Queen Catherine II. What I wouldn't give to make a dress for that body."

"How have things been in Tolis?" you ask.

"Avana suffered far more damage, but we are still rebuilding as well. It would have been a lot worse without you and your friends, though."

Mr. Stone glances over. "Who is this again?"

"Kyle Warren! You know, the Hero King everyone is talking about? Ruler of Castle Phoenix to the east?" Ms. Labing explains.

"Ah. Right. I remember seeing your wanted poster in the past. If it's any consolation, I thought King Thadius a fool the moment he took the throne. I think plenty of people did. The current queen is too beloved to be so easily replaced. The only followers he had were those eager to hate. Those who wanted a leader to give them enemies. A waste of time. Time better spent making shoes."

"You're dressed up awfully fancy for simply watching a speech," Ms. Labing says. She leans in close to you and smirks. "Are the rumours true then, that she won't be the only person up there?"

You shrug. "Maybe."

"And to think. Such a famous person went to our school."

"I mean, I wasn't there very long. I don't know if that counts or not."

"It's even better! You saved all of Redbloom Academy. You're a gift that keeps on giving."

Mr. Stone makes his way over with the finished footwear in his hands. "Here, good sir. Please try them on."

Me again, huh? You nod, and then take your place once again at Xiaoqing's feet. You slowly slip each one on, and then shift back as all in the room can finally take in the sight of her completed wardrobe. You stand first, and take her hand to aid her. She looks down in awe as her toes practically sparkle.

While not tall heels, they're heels regardless, with glistening straps over the tops of her feet like frozen streams of water. Upon the middle toe of her right foot, there's a single sapphire gemstone. She lifts her legs up and down, and then steps carefully across the room. With a surprisingly playful spin, she looks back to her audience with a smile and a bow. "They're perfect. I don't know how to thank everybody for being so kind to me today."

"One of you can thank me with payment," says Mr. Stone.

Ms. Labing elbows him in the side. "Brother!"

"That wasn't meant to be rude. I was simply trying to help."
